THe fighter salaries resulting from Sunday night’s UFC Fight Night 103 event are in and show that despite his tough loss, BJ Penn was still the highest earner on the card, taking home $150,000.
Another veteran campaigner, Joe Lauzon was next up with $116,000 following his win in the co-main event, while Yair Rodriguez banked $100,00 for the biggest victory of his career to date.
They were the only fighters to take home a six-figure basic salary on the night, with the next highest being the $54,000 Sergio Pettis took home for his win on the night, while Aleksei Oleinik was on $48,000.
As always, keep in mind that these figures are solely based on the fighter’s basic salary and doesn’t include additional earnings from things like sponsorship money and post-fight bonuses.
Check out all the UFC Fight Night 103 salaries below.
—
Yair Rodriguez: $100,000 ($50,000 win bonus)
B.J. Penn: $150,000
Joe Lauzon: $116,000 ($58,000 win bonus)
Marcin Held: $20,000
Ben Saunders: $40,000 ($20,000 win bonus)
Court McGee: $35,000
Sergio Pettis: $54,000 ($27,000 win bonus)
John Moraga: $28,000
Drakkar Klose: $20,000 ($10,000 win bonus)
Devin Powell: $10,000
Augusto Mendes: $20,000 ($10,000 win bonus)
Frankie Saenz: $20,000
Aleksei Oleinik: $48,000 ($24,000 win bonus)
Viktor Pesta: $10,000
Tony Martin: $32,000 ($16,000 win bonus)
Alex White: $14,000
Nina Ansaroff: $20,000 ($10,000 win bonus)
Jocelyn Jones-Lybarger: $10,000
Walt Harris: $24,000 ($12,000 win bonus)
Chase Sherman: $10,000
Joachim Christensen: $20,000 ($10,000 win bonus)
Bojan Mihajlovic: $10,000
Cyril Asker: $20,000 ($10,000 win bonus)
Dmitrii Smoliakov: $10,000
